If you like tinkering with overclocking FSB, PCI Vcore...etc, then Abit is just the killer board. I've bought six 6 so far and haven't had any trouble to speak of.
And, you can up the FSB without adding to the PCI bus.
However I 've heard the Sis chipset is much better than the Via and it's notorious 686 south bridge.
